| Hello Buddy. So, whatever happened to the
population that inhabited the Celtic Island of Britain
before the Romans came to invade it?. Well, the Celtic
Ancient Britain's of the 'Isle of Britain'(or also called
Ynys Prydain) were the ancestors of the present day 'Welsh'(meaning
one who has lived under Roman rule). After being invaded by the Romans, who sought invasion to capture Britain's Gold and Ore mines, the various tribes that inhabited the island eventually retired from their un-defendable flat plains of central Britain, to the mountainous regions of their Western Peninsular stronghold, the present day Principality of Wales. The tribes were, eventually, like the rest of Celtic Europe, subjugated by Roman military expansion and occupation. Some of The Great Welsh Tribal Leaders were King 'Caractacus' (Caradog), Queen Boudicca (Boadicea) and King Arthur of The Britain's (whose round table legend was actually brought about, by the shape of the remains of a Roman amphitheatre at Caerleon Gwent). |
Welsh (meaning one who has been
under Roman Rule, is a word from Germanic language). Cymru (Wales) was a word first used around the sixth century A.D. and means land of fellow countrymen. |

MY HISTORY NOTES 500,000BC Cave dwellers and hunter gatherers occupy the island (which at this time is still connected to the mainland of Europe).The loss of the land link to Europe, which was engulfed be the ocean around 6500bc,lead the inhabitants to eventually form a fragmented tribal culture for mutual benefit. 1400BC North Wales tribes export bronze and copper goods to Europe. 1000BC Blue stone blocks from Pembrokeshire are moved to make Stonehenge religious site. The tribal people now have the knowledge of complex astronomy and mathematics, they value life, creating Cromlech burial chambers to celebrate the lifespan of the deceased, usually Chieftains. Celtic culture is in emergence and expands. 550BC Complex hill forts dominate important inhabited areas. 200BC Nomadic Iberian adventurers settle the island of Britain, joining a flood of Celts, who now settled in even larger numbers while seeking refuge from Roman expansion of Gaul, they now become the main dominant culture on the island. 55BC Romans who control the Celtic Gaul area of Europe land on Britain in Kent but meet fierce resistance from tribal Celts. They withdraw. 54BC Romans land and invade Kent area again, in force, starting a full scale invasion and have many successful pitched battles with the Celts. With continuing fierce resistance and a guerrilla campaign waged against them, the Romans withdraw across the channel to Gaul for the winter. 43AD Romans invade again, but with overwhelming and determined force. The superior tactics and weaponry of the Roman army outmatch the resistance from the Celtic Tribes and gradually they are subdued, resorting to a guerrilla campaign so as to avoid, where possible, an open battle. King Caradog (Caractacus) organises the defence, commanding the Ordovices and Silurian Tribes and he enlists the help of various tribes that inhabit the present day Wales area. 51AD Caractacus defeated in a pitched battle with Roman army. He escapes but is betrayed by the Brigantes tribe, captured and sent to Rome. He humbles the Roman Emperor and people with his defiance and dignified honesty, they pardon him for his crime of resisting Roman aggression. A great Roman fortress was built at Caerleon on Usk South Wales, as a base to subdue the tribes who still resisted after the loss of their leader, it was attacked many times causing large losses to the Romans, but the fortress also depleted the Britain's fighting strength allowing them to gain the upper hand. 60AD Queen Boudicca leads a revolt against Roman occupation. Romans attack Druid stronghold of Anglesey island and destroy most of the religious order. Queen Boudicca destroys London while Roman troops are too few to resist and occupied in Anglesey. Romans gather strength and defeat the British in a pitched battle in the midland area. Queen Boudicca commits suicide. 77AD Romans defeat last organised tribal resistance on the island. Also Romans complete the destruction of the Druid faith by again crossing to the island of Anglesey and slaughtering the remaining priests. 383-484AD Roman rule
ends on the island of Britain. They withdraw back to
Italy to defend their shrinking Empire and leave the
islanders to defend themselves. The British have no
single organised army or dominant King or Queen, so
Chieftains assert their own local control. The Roman
Empire itself eventually disintegrates under constant
attacks and border changes. 490AD Picts tribe raid from Northern Scotland and Saxons from Germanic areas invade. King Arthur of the Britain's defeat the Saxons in pitched battles, saving Wales from occupation and starting his Legend. North, of Welsh Britain (Lower Scotland) and Welsh Cornwall both separated from Wales become overrun. The present day Welsh language starts to form from Brythonic mixed with Latin. 645AD Cadwaladr a Local Welsh King of Gwynedd fights English Local King Of Northumbria. The Welsh of lower Scotland are finally forced to leave, leaving the Scots to become a totally dominant culture there. |
